Bathinda: Two Bike borne riders charred to death in bus-bike collision

Bathinda: Two Bike borne riders charred to death in bus-bike collision

Bathinda, November 21:  A tragic road mishap has been reported in Bathinda wherein two Bike borne riders were charred to death in bus-bike collision near Bathinda. According to the preliminary reports, 'Deep' bus caught fire near Gurthadi in Sangat Mandi, Bathinda which was on its way back from Salasar.

As per inputs, both vehicles caught fire after collision, in which  a woman and a man riding a motorcycle were charred to death while bus passengers were reported safe. 

The bus full of pilgrims was returning from Salasar, Rajasthan. The accident happened near village Machhana and Gurthadi on the Bathinda-Dabwali national highway. In the accident, both the bus and the motorcycle were burnt to ashes on the road.

According to the details obtained, a collision between a bus and a bullet motorcycle took place between village Machhana and Gurthadi. The collision was so fierce that both the vehicles caught fire, as a result of which the two occupants of the bike were burnt alive. 

When the bus caught fire, the bus passengers got down safely, which prevented further casualties, but the bus was burnt to ashes on the road. As soon as the incident was reported, the fire brigade vehicle were rushed to the spot.

DSP Bathinda rural Narinder Singh and other police team are doing further investigation.
